### Runbook: Date localization in Carthonix

If dates render in the wrong format for a locale, don't patch templates — the formatter reads locale rules from config at boot. Nine times out of ten someone changed the fallback locale or disabled the CLDR bundle. Restart after any change; the cache is sticky. The known-good settings for the formatter are below.

deployment values, kajep-kageg:
[praix]
host = praix.paliqcorp.corp
user = praix_svc
database = praix_prod

Subject: Quota cut-over complete. Team — the move to per-tenant rate quotas on Harrowmill API finished at 02:10. All tenants migrated; legacy global limiter is disabled but code remains for one release. If a tenant reports throttling, check their tier mapping before touching limits. Overrides expire automatically after 24 hours. The active quota configuration now in production is shown below.

config for kafof-bawef:
holath:
  log_level: debug
  metrics_host: metrics.holath.qorvelsys.internal
  pin: 2191
  pool_size: 32

## Handover: cron migration to Weftflow

We're moving the remaining Opalgrid cron jobs onto the Weftflow workflow engine. Eleven jobs are done; six remain, all in the billing namespace. Each migrated job needs its schedule translated and its retry policy declared explicitly, since Weftflow has no implicit retries. The staging Weftflow instance is already provisioned. Register each migrated workflow using the following configuration values.

settings of kageg-yawig:
[casix]
host = casix.tolvaqlabs.corp
user = casix_svc
database = casix_prod

**Checklist: encoding detection for uploads**

Verify the Fennwick upload service correctly sniffs UTF-8, UTF-16 (both endianness), and legacy Latin-9 text files. Run the corpus in `encodings/fixtures` through the detector; zero misclassifications allowed. Confirm BOM-stripped files still resolve correctly and that mojibake alerts fire on forced Shift-mislabels. If anything fails, roll back the detector module only — not the whole ingest tier. Record results against the staging build, stamped below.

session token of fahap-hawip = htk31_7852f2b3276dba2738f98fa97f92237